QOJ.ac

QOJ

IDProblemSubmitterResultTimeMemoryLanguageFile sizeSubmit timeJudge time
#474477#3098. Ancient Machineegypt_ioi2024b_040 52ms10160kbC++203.0kb2024-07-12 19:02:372024-07-12 19:02:38

Details

Tip: Click on the bar to expand more detailed information

Subtask #1:

score: 0
Wrong Answer

Test #1:

score: 100
Accepted
time: 0ms
memory: 3868kb

input:

18
Y X Y Z X Z X X Z Z Y Y Z Y Y Z X X

output:

38
11111000100001101001111101001000000000

input:

38
11111000100001101001111101001000000000

output:

0 38 3

result:

ok n = 18, D = 38, L = 3

Test #2:

score: 100
Accepted
time: 0ms
memory: 3820kb

input:

18
X Z X Y Y Y X Z X Y Z Z Z Z Y Z Z Y

output:

38
10001101100001001110111000101000000000

input:

38
10001101100001001110111000101000000000

output:

0 38 3

result:

ok n = 18, D = 38, L = 3

Test #3:

score: 100
Accepted
time: 0ms
memory: 3832kb

input:

18
Y Z Z Y Z X X Z Y Y Z Z Z Y X X Z Y

output:

38
11111000101010011101010010000000000000

input:

38
11111000101010011101010010000000000000

output:

0 38 2

result:

ok n = 18, D = 38, L = 2

Test #4:

score: 100
Accepted
time: 0ms
memory: 3816kb

input:

18
X Z Z X Z X X Z X Y Y X X Z X Y Z X

output:

38
01100111110111100100011101111000000000

input:

38
01100111110111100100011101111000000000

output:

0 38 2

result:

ok n = 18, D = 38, L = 2

Test #5:

score: 0
Wrong Answer
time: 0ms
memory: 3764kb

input:

18
X Y X Y Y X X Z Y Z Y X Z Y Y X X Z

output:

38
10111010010111010111110100101000000000

input:

38
10111010010111010111110100101000000000

output:

0 38 4

result:

wrong answer your query is valid but your solution is not optimal: read 4 but expected 5

Subtask #2:

score: 0
Wrong Answer

Test #12:

score: 69
Acceptable Answer
time: 16ms
memory: 10088kb

input:

100000
X Z X Z Z X Y Z Y X Y X Z Z Z Y X Z Y X Y Y X Y Y Y Z Y Z Z Y X X Y X X Y Y X X X Z Y Y Y Z Z Z Z Y X Y Y Z Z Z X Y Z X X X X Y X Y X X Z X Z Z Z X Y X X X Z X Z X X X Y Y Y Y Z X X Y Z Y Y X Z X Z Z Z Z Z Y Z Y X Y Y Y Y X Z Z Y Z Z Y Z Z Z X Z Z X X Z Z Z Z X X Z Y Y Z Y Y Z Z Y Y Z Y Z Y Z...

output:

92501
110000100000101111001010111010000000000011101110001001100010100110000000000100000111001011010111000010100000000000100000001100100111101000110000000000010010111110100011110111100000000000011010001111011000010001010000000000010001000100110010011110110000000000000000011100001101101000001101000000...

input:

92501
110000100000101111001010111010000000000011101110001001100010100110000000000100000111001011010111000010100000000000100000001100100111101000110000000000010010111110100011110111100000000000011010001111011000010001010000000000010001000100110010011110110000000000000000011100001101101000001101000000...

output:

0 92501 22133

result:

points 0.69473684210 n = 100000, D = 92501, L = 22133

Test #13:

score: 69
Acceptable Answer
time: 42ms
memory: 9952kb

input:

100000
Z X X Y Z Z Z Y Z X Y Y Z X X Z Z Z Y Z X Y X Y X Z Y X Z X Y X Y Y Z X X Z X Z Y Z Y Z Z Z Y X Z X Z Y Y Y Z Y Z Y Z X Y X Z Z X Y X Y Z X Y Z Y X Y X X Z Z X Z X X Z X X X X Y X X Z Z X Y Y Y Y X Y X X Z Y Z Y Y Z X X Z Z Y Y X Z Y Y X Y Z Y Z Y Y Z Z X Z Y Z Z Z X Y Z Z X X X X Z Y X Y Y Z...

output:

92501
101100100110111100000100100100000000000001110101000010001100101110000000000101010010111011101011100001100000000001000111110100101111011001110000000000000110010010000001001000110000000000010011110101110110111100111000000000001000110110010001011111000100000000000110011000100111110110011101000000...

input:

92501
101100100110111100000100100100000000000001110101000010001100101110000000000101010010111011101011100001100000000001000111110100101111011001110000000000000110010010000001001000110000000000010011110101110110111100111000000000001000110110010001011111000100000000000110011000100111110110011101000000...

output:

0 92501 22275

result:

points 0.69473684210 n = 100000, D = 92501, L = 22275

Test #14:

score: 69
Acceptable Answer
time: 20ms
memory: 9860kb

input:

100000
X Z Y X Z X X Z Y Z Y Y Y Z Y Z X X Z X X Y Z X X Z Y X Y Y Z X Z Y Z X X X X Z X Y X Z X Z X X X Y X Y Z Z Z Z Z Z Z Z Y X Y Z X Z Y Z Y X Y Z Y Z Y X Y Z X Z Z Z Y X Y Y X X X X Y X X Y Z Z X Z Y Z Z Y X Y X Z Z Z X X Z X Z Z Z Z Y X Z Z X X Z Z Y X X Y Y Y X Y Y Y X X Y Y Z X Z Y Y X X Y Z...

output:

92501
100000100011001010111001111010000000001100001101101001000111001100000000000100111010101110000111000011000000000000010001001100001010101001000000000000100100001001101000111110000000000000100101100011110001000100110000000000011000100000010100100010000100000000000101010111101111010011101100000000...

input:

92501
100000100011001010111001111010000000001100001101101001000111001100000000000100111010101110000111000011000000000000010001001100001010101001000000000000100100001001101000111110000000000000100101100011110001000100110000000000011000100000010100100010000100000000000101010111101111010011101100000000...

output:

0 92501 22177

result:

points 0.69473684210 n = 100000, D = 92501, L = 22177

Test #15:

score: 69
Acceptable Answer
time: 26ms
memory: 10032kb

input:

100000
Y Z X X X Y Y Y Z Y Z X Z X X Z X X Z X X Z Z X Z Z Z Z X X X Z X Y X X Y X Y X Z Y X Z Y Z Y Y Y Y Z Y Z X X X X Y Y Z Y X Y X Y Y Z X Z Z Y Z Z Y X X Z Y Y Y Z Y X Y Y Y Y Z Z Y Z X X Y X Z Z Y X Y Y X Z Y X Y Y Y Z Y X X Y X Z X Y X X X Y Y Y Y Y X Z Z Y Z X Y Y X X X X Z Z X X X Y Z X Z X...

output:

92501
000101000011001001010001110000000000000000010011011110110011001011000000000000100010110100001010100010100000000000010011000000110001111000000000000001000011001011101010010101101000000000011000010000001111101100110100000000011110000010000010101001111100000000001001111010110010011010100100000000...

input:

92501
000101000011001001010001110000000000000000010011011110110011001011000000000000100010110100001010100010100000000000010011000000110001111000000000000001000011001011101010010101101000000000011000010000001111101100110100000000011110000010000010101001111100000000001001111010110010011010100100000000...

output:

0 92501 22192

result:

points 0.69473684210 n = 100000, D = 92501, L = 22192

Test #16:

score: 69
Acceptable Answer
time: 34ms
memory: 9908kb

input:

100000
Z Z X Y Z Z Z Z Y X Y Y Z X Y Y Y Z X X Z X X X Z Y X X Z Y X X Y Y Z Y Y Z Z Y Z Z Y Y X X Z X Y Y Z Z Y Z X X Y X Z X X Y Z Z Y X X Z Z Z Y Z Z X X Z X Z Z Z Y X X Z Z X X X Z X X Z Y X X Y X Y Z X Y Z Z X X X Y Y Z Z Z Z X X X X Y X Z X Z X X Z X Y X Z Z X Y X X Z Z X X Y X Z Z Z Z X Y Y Y...

output:

92501
110101010110010110010010000100000000001100111110001010000111010110000000000010000001001100111001101100000000000001001001101010111101011000110000000000101011010101011111111000000000000000001100111111111100000101110000000000011100110000000100110111001100000000001101100011111110001110001000000000...

input:

92501
110101010110010110010010000100000000001100111110001010000111010110000000000010000001001100111001101100000000000001001001101010111101011000110000000000101011010101011111111000000000000000001100111111111100000101110000000000011100110000000100110111001100000000001101100011111110001110001000000000...

output:

0 92501 22119

result:

points 0.69473684210 n = 100000, D = 92501, L = 22119

Test #17:

score: 69
Acceptable Answer
time: 40ms
memory: 9856kb

input:

100000
X X Y Y Y Y X Z Z X Y Y X Y X Z Y Y Y Y X X Y X X Y Y X Z X Z Z Z Y Z Y Y Y X Y Y Z Y Z X Z Y Z Z X Z Z X Z Y Z Z Z Y Z X Y Y Y X Y Y Y X X X X X Z X Y X Z Y Y Z X Z Z X Y X X X Z Z Z X X X X Z Y X X Y Z X Z Z X X Y X Z Z Y X X X Y X X X X Z Y Z X X X Z X Z Z Y Y Y Z Y Y X Z Y Y X Y Y X Y X X...

output:

92501
001101111100001001000101001100000000000001000101110000010110011001000000000010010111010111100000010001100000000001110111101011001110101001110000000000111001011110010010110000110000000000011100001001011000001110110100000000010100111101011001101101111000000000001100010010011101010101000010000000...

input:

92501
001101111100001001000101001100000000000001000101110000010110011001000000000010010111010111100000010001100000000001110111101011001110101001110000000000111001011110010010110000110000000000011100001001011000001110110100000000010100111101011001101101111000000000001100010010011101010101000010000000...

output:

0 92501 22256

result:

points 0.69473684210 n = 100000, D = 92501, L = 22256

Test #18:

score: 69
Acceptable Answer
time: 42ms
memory: 10160kb

input:

100000
X Z Z X Z X Z Z X X X Z Z Y Y Z Y Y Z Z Y X X Y Y Z Y Y Y Y Y Z X Y X Y X Z Z X Y X Z Z Y Z Y Z X Z Y Y Y Y Z X X Y X X X X Y Y Z Z X Y X Y Z Y Y Y Z X Y Y X Z Y Y Z Z X Y Y Y Y Y Y X Z Y X Z X Y Y Z Z X Z Z X Z Z Z X X Y X Y Z Z X X Y X Z Z Z X X Y Z X Z Y Z Z X X X X X Z Y X Y Z X Z X Z Z X...

output:

92501
000011001110111001010111011110000000001001001011100001110011011100000000000111101101001101001111010010000000000010011010001000100101011011100000000001100001000011111001111111100000000000111101111010010101111010111000000000000010110100011101001010010000000000000011100001011011010000110101000000...

input:

92501
000011001110111001010111011110000000001001001011100001110011011100000000000111101101001101001111010010000000000010011010001000100101011011100000000001100001000011111001111111100000000000111101111010010101111010111000000000000010110100011101001010010000000000000011100001011011010000110101000000...

output:

0 92501 22071

result:

points 0.69473684210 n = 100000, D = 92501, L = 22071

Test #19:

score: 69
Acceptable Answer
time: 42ms
memory: 9992kb

input:

100000
X Z X Y Z Z X Y X X Y Y X Z Z X Z X X X Z Y Z X X X X Y Z Y Y X X Y Y Z Y Y Z X X X Y Z Y Z Z Y Z Y X Z Z Y X X Y Y Z Y X Z X X Y Z Y Z Z Z Z Z X Y Y X Y Y X Y Y Y Y X X Y Y X Y Z Y Y Y Y X X X X X X X Y X Y X Z Y Y Y X Z X Y X Y Z X Y Z Y X Y Y X X Y X X Z Y X X X Y Y Z Y Z X Y X Y Y Y X Z Z...

output:

92501
101011110111111010110001101010000000001001111111010110111110001100000000000110000101000001010000100000000000000001111010100110100001110000000000000001101111101010011010111011110000000000001010100110001000010011010000000000011100100001000011001110011000000000001010110011000010111100011011000000...

input:

92501
101011110111111010110001101010000000001001111111010110111110001100000000000110000101000001010000100000000000000001111010100110100001110000000000000001101111101010011010111011110000000000001010100110001000010011010000000000011100100001000011001110011000000000001010110011000010111100011011000000...

output:

0 92501 22257

result:

points 0.69473684210 n = 100000, D = 92501, L = 22257

Test #20:

score: 69
Acceptable Answer
time: 16ms
memory: 10032kb

input:

99997
X X Z X Z X Y Z Y X Y Z X X Y Y Z X Y Y X Z Z Y Y X X Z Y Z Y X Y X Y Y Y Y Z Z X Z X Z Z Z X X Y Z Z X X Y X X Y Z Y Z Z Z Z Y X Y Z Z X X X Z Z Z Y Z Z Y Y Y X Z Y X X Z Z Y Z Y Y Z Z Z X Z X X X Z Y Z X Z Y Y X X Z Y Y Z X Z Z X Z Z Z Z X X Z Y Z Y Y X Y Y Y Z X Y Y Y Y Z Y X Y X Y Z X X X ...

output:

92501
111000011110100001111011111100000000000000011001000101010010001110000000000001111111000110011000111011000000000000101101011110001100001010100000000001110010001000101111000111100000000000000011100101101111011011101100000000010010001011110100011010001100000000000101101110001001100100000010000000...

input:

92501
111000011110100001111011111100000000000000011001000101010010001110000000000001111111000110011000111011000000000000101101011110001100001010100000000001110010001000101111000111100000000000000011100101101111011011101100000000010010001011110100011010001100000000000101101110001001100100000010000000...

output:

0 92501 22040

result:

points 0.69473684210 n = 99997, D = 92501, L = 22040

Test #21:

score: 69
Acceptable Answer
time: 32ms
memory: 9988kb

input:

99996
X X Z Y X X Y Y X Y Z X X Y Z Z Z X Z Y Z Y Y Y Z Z Z X Z Z X Y X X X Z Y Y X X Y Y Z X Z Y X X X Y X X Z Z X Z Z Y Z X Z X Z Y Z Z X Y Z Z X Y X X Z Z X X Y Z Z X X X Z X Z X Z Y X X X X Z X Z Z Z X Z X Z Y X X Y Z Y Z Z X Y Y X X X X X Y Z Z Z Z Y Z Z Z Z Z Z Y X Y Y X Y X X X X Y Y Y Y X Z ...

output:

92501
101100110001100111111010001100000000000101100011011010001111001010000000000101101010011011010101000001100000000010010001001111110001011001000000000000001101111011101010101000010000000000001011111101100000101101000000000000001100000011001000110100110000000000001000000111000011100100100110000000...

input:

92501
101100110001100111111010001100000000000101100011011010001111001010000000000101101010011011010101000001100000000010010001001111110001011001000000000000001101111011101010101000010000000000001011111101100000101101000000000000001100000011001000110100110000000000001000000111000011100100100110000000...

output:

0 92501 22360

result:

points 0.69473684210 n = 99996, D = 92501, L = 22360

Test #22:

score: 69
Acceptable Answer
time: 42ms
memory: 10080kb

input:

99995
X Z X Y Y Y X X X Y Z Z Z X Y Y X Y X X Z Z X X Y Y X Z Z X Z Z X Z X X Y Z X X Z Z Y Y Y Y Z Y X X Z Y Z Z Y X X Y Z Y Y Z Z Z X Y X Y Z Z Z Z X Z Z Z Y Z Y Z Z Y X Z Y Y Z Y Y X X Z Y X Y Y Y Y X Y Z X Z Z X Z Y Z Z Z Y X X X Y Z Y Z Y Y Y X Z Z Z Z Z Y Y Z Y X X Y Y X Y X Y Y X Y Z Z X X X ...

output:

92501
111100011100000010110011110010000000001111010001010100000000110110000000000111010111010110100110011001100000000000000010001010000111010100000000000001001010010110010101100111000000000000100111100110001000111000000100000000001001101101100101001000000000000000001010000100100101011100011010000000...

input:

92501
111100011100000010110011110010000000001111010001010100000000110110000000000111010111010110100110011001100000000000000010001010000111010100000000000001001010010110010101100111000000000000100111100110001000111000000100000000001001101101100101001000000000000000001010000100100101011100011010000000...

output:

0 92501 22233

result:

points 0.69473684210 n = 99995, D = 92501, L = 22233

Test #23:

score: 69
Acceptable Answer
time: 42ms
memory: 10092kb

input:

99994
Z Z Z X Z Y X Y Y Z X Z X Y Y Y X X X Y Z Y X Z Z Y Z Z Z Z X Z Z Y Y Y Z X Y X Z X Z X X Z X Z Y X Z Y Z X Y X Y X Z X Z Y X Z X X X X X X Y X Z X Y X Z Y X X Z Y Z Y Y Y X Z X X X Y X Z Z X Z X Z Y Y Y Z Z Z X Y X X X Y Z Z Z X X X Y Y Y Z X Z X Y X X Y X Z Y Z X Z Y X X Z X Y Z X X Z Y X X ...

output:

92501
100110000100010010100000101000000000000101010011011110110111110111000000000001100011101110011111111101100000000011111000111100101110101110110000000000000101000101110101011010110000000000011011011010011101010100001000000000001100011001111101101100101100000000000011111011110110000010011011000000...

input:

92501
100110000100010010100000101000000000000101010011011110110111110111000000000001100011101110011111111101100000000011111000111100101110101110110000000000000101000101110101011010110000000000011011011010011101010100001000000000001100011001111101101100101100000000000011111011110110000010011011000000...

output:

0 92501 22316

result:

points 0.69473684210 n = 99994, D = 92501, L = 22316

Test #24:

score: 0
Wrong Answer
time: 52ms
memory: 9848kb

input:

100000
X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X Y X...

output:

92501
110110110101100010111101110010000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000...

input:

92501
110110110101100010111101110010000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000...

output:

0 92501 49998

result:

wrong answer your query is valid but your solution is not optimal: read 49998 but expected 49999